OVERVIEW

Acute and Chronic Pulmonary Thromboembolism is organized by University of Pittsburgh Medical Center (UPMC).

Release Date: 03/31/2017
Last Modified: 04/07/2020
Expires: 03/31/2021

Accreditation:
The University of Pittsburgh School of Medicine designates this enduring material for a maximum of .75 AMA PRA Category 1 Credits™. Each physician should only claim credit commensurate with the extent of their participation in the activity. Other health care professionals are awarded (0.075) continuing education units (CEU) which are equivalent to .75 contact hour.

Successful completion of this CME activity, which includes participation in the evaluation component, enables the participant to earn up to .75 MOC points in the American Board of Internal Medicine's (ABIM) Maintenance of Certification (MOC) program.

Educational objectives: 
Upon completion of this activity, participants should be able to:
• Describe the epidemiology and natural history of acute pulmonary embolus
• List and compare the clinical classification of acute pulmonary embolus
